Which Materials Make Sport Bike Levers Unbreakable?
The materials that make sport bike levers unbreakable include advanced alloys and composites designed for durability and strength.
- Aircraft-grade aluminum
- Carbon fiber
- Stainless steel
- Titanium
- Magnesium alloys
The diverse opinions on material choice can affect performance and weight balance.
-
Aircraft-grade aluminum: Aircraft-grade aluminum is lightweight and highly resistant to corrosion. Many manufacturers choose this material because it offers a good balance between strength and weight, making it ideal for sport bike levers that require durability without adding excess weight.
-
Carbon fiber: Carbon fiber is known for its high strength-to-weight ratio. It is more rigid than aluminum yet significantly lighter. This material absorbs vibrations well, providing better feedback to the rider. High-performance bikes often utilize carbon fiber for lever construction to enhance control and responsiveness.
-
Stainless steel: Stainless steel is chosen for its resistance to rust and corrosion. This makes it suitable for environments with moisture, such as when riding in rain. Its inherent strength contributes to the overall durability of levers, but it adds weight compared to aluminum and carbon fiber.
-
Titanium: Titanium is exceptionally strong and lightweight but comes at a higher cost. It offers excellent resistance to impact and fatigue, which is beneficial for high-stress usages like racing. Titanium levers can withstand significant forces without bending or breaking, making them a popular choice for professional racers.
-
Magnesium alloys: Magnesium alloys are lightweight and have good resistance to impact. They provide a suitable strength-to-weight ratio and are often used in high-performance applications. However, magnesium can be susceptible to corrosion, so additional coatings are typically applied to extend its lifespan.
These materials all present their unique advantages, impacting performance, weight, and cost. Riders must choose based on their specific needs and preferences, considering factors such as the intended use of their sport bike and the conditions in which they ride.

How to Select the Best Sport Bike Levers for Your Riding Style?
To select the best sport bike levers for your riding style, consider factors such as comfort, adjustability, and compatibility with your bike.
Begin by evaluating the type of riding you do. Street riders may prefer levers that offer comfort for long durations. Track riders might look for levers that enable quick and precise input. Next, consider the materials. Aluminum levers are lightweight and durable. Plastic levers may be less expensive but can be less robust.
Adjustability is another key aspect. Some levers feature adjustable reach, allowing riders to fine-tune the distance between the lever and the handlebar. This can enhance comfort and control. Look for levers that are easy to install and compatible with your bike’s make and model. Many brands provide specific compatibility lists to help you choose the right option.
When comparing different types of levers, analyze their design and features. Standard levers are typically the most affordable option. Shorty levers reduce the distance needed to fully engage the brake or clutch, allowing for faster operation. On the other hand, adjustable levers offer customization of both reach and angle, providing a tailored experience.
To select the best levers, follow these steps:
1. Identify your riding style and preferences.
2. Research lever materials and construction.
3. Check if the levers are adjustable or standard.
4. Confirm compatibility with your sport bike model.
5. Read reviews and gather feedback from other riders.
Prioritize comfort and function based on how you ride. Try out different lever styles if possible, as personal preference plays a significant role in your choice.
What Should You Consider for Proper Installation of Sport Bike Levers?
Proper installation of sport bike levers requires attention to several important factors.
- Compatibility with the motorcycle model
- Material quality of the levers
- Adjustability features
- Ergonomics for rider comfort
- Proper tightening torque of screws
- Brake fluid level adjustment (for brake levers)
- Lever positioning for accessibility
- Inspection for clearances and obstructions
Understanding these factors helps ensure safety and performance on the road.
-
Compatibility with the motorcycle model:
Compatibility with the motorcycle model is essential for proper installation of sport bike levers. Levers must match the specific make and model of the bike for optimal fit and function. Manufacturers often provide lists of compatible models, ensuring that the lever will operate correctly with the existing brake and clutch systems. -
Material quality of the levers:
Material quality of the levers greatly affects durability and performance. High-quality levers are often made from aluminum or carbon fiber, providing strength while remaining lightweight. Lower-quality plastic levers may break easily and compromise safety. The choice of materials can influence responsiveness and the overall feel during riding. -
Adjustability features:
Adjustability features allow riders to customize lever position and reach. Many sport bike levers offer multiple settings, accommodating different hand sizes and riding styles. This customization enhances rider comfort and control, especially in high-stakes situations such as racing or aggressive riding. -
Ergonomics for rider comfort:
Ergonomics for rider comfort play a crucial role in long rides or high-performance scenarios. Well-designed levers reduce hand fatigue and enhance grip, which is important for maintaining control. An ergonomic design can also prevent strain injuries, allowing riders to enjoy longer rides without discomfort. -
Proper tightening torque of screws:
Proper tightening torque of screws is vital for reliability and safety. Over-tightening can lead to lever damage or stripping of the threads. Conversely, under-tightening may result in levers loosening during operation, which poses a safety risk. Mechanics often refer to torque specifications outlined by the manufacturer to achieve proper installation. -
Brake fluid level adjustment (for brake levers):
Brake fluid level adjustment is necessary when installing brake levers. The brake lever should be positioned correctly to activate the brake system effectively. If the fluid level is low, it can lead to poor braking performance. Regular checks ensure that the brake system operates optimally after lever installation. -
Lever positioning for accessibility:
Lever positioning for accessibility is crucial for safe operation. Riders should position levers within easy reach without sacrificing comfort. A well-placed lever improves reaction times during emergency situations. Riders often test different positions before settling on the most comfortable and accessible one. -
Inspection for clearances and obstructions:
Inspection for clearances and obstructions ensures that the levers operate freely without interference. This process includes checking for proper clearance with the bike’s body and ensuring no cables or hoses pass too close to the levers. Failure to conduct this inspection can lead to malfunction or damage while riding.
